Onboarding note — cold storage archiving (Bramblewick stack). Buckets untouched for 180 days get swept by the Mothwing archiver into glacier-tier storage every Sunday night. Don't delete the manifest files; restores depend on them. Each archive batch is signed before upload so the restore tool can verify integrity. The signing key the archiver currently uses is the one below.

deploy key for yajeg-hahog: bky3_BZq

As part of Q3 planning, Brindlecote Systems will close its small Harlowe Street satellite office, which currently houses nine staff. All affected roles move to remote arrangements or transfer to the Eastmere site. Lease termination costs, equipment disposal, and relocation stipends are estimated within the contingency already reserved. Finance should book the one-time charges in Q3 and remove the recurring facility costs from Q4 onward. Further confidential detail on the surrounding plans is provided below.

confidential, kagup-bafog: Fraaxax Group is in early talks to buy Soroxox Group for about $343.8 million. The Olidor launch date is June 14, and nothing goes to the press before then. Legal wants the Aldmirek Logistics term sheet signed before July 23.

Hey — handing off the Fennelworks password reset revamp. Token flow is done, rate limiting is merged, and the email templates cleared review on Tuesday. Only open item is the expiry copy on the mobile screen. For the release, everything is gated behind flags, and the service boots with these values.

settings of yaguf-fajof:
[druvan]
host = druvan.plorvatech.example
user = druvan_svc
database = druvan_prod

☐ Key Ceremony Step 7 — Unseal billing-worker deploy keys

Before cutting over the Tidepool billing worker from blue to green, two custodians must unseal the signing-key vault together. Confirm the green pool passed the invoice replay check and that blue remains on standby for instant rollback. Record both custodian names in the ceremony log. Once witnesses confirm, unseal the vault using the recovery passphrase below.

strongbox words: belys-sorael-novvan-belael-pelmir-kelmir-lamath